Storm closes several Seacoast roads and creates slippery travel conditions on several area highways.
CONCORD, N.H. (AP) – Many schools in New Hampshire schools were closed or delayed Friday and many vehicles ran into accidents on slick roads as a winter storm moved through the state.
Route 1A flooded and the police departments in Rye and North Hampton closed the road as the storm hit the Seacoast.
State Police in the Bedford area said they responded to 93 motor vehicle crashes, vehicles off the roadway and disabled motorists. Most of the accidents happened on the Everett Turnpike, Interstate 293 and Interstate 93, causing significant traffic delays earlier in the day.
Police said in one of the incidents, a trooper's cruiser was swiped by a passing driver while he was dealing with an accident. The trooper suffered minor injuries.
